Ux

JavaScript Snippets For Better UX and User Interface #.\n\nJavaScript can be made use of to dramatically boost the consumer take in (UX) and interface (UI) of your internet site. In this article, we will review some JavaScript snippets that you can use to increase the UX as well as UI of your site.\n\nINFINITE DOWNLOADS: 500,000+ WordPress &amp Design Resources.\nSign up for Envato Components as well as obtain unlimited downloads beginning at simply $16.50 per month!\n\n\n\nDOWNLOAD NOW.\n\nHassle-free Scrolling.\nHassle-free scrolling is a popular UX component that creates scrolling via web pages smoother and more fluid. Through this component, as opposed to abruptly hopping to the next segment of the web page, the individual will definitely be properly transitioned to the following part.\nTo add hassle-free scrolling to your website, you can easily utilize the observing JavaScript code:.\n\n$(' a [href *=\" #\"]). on(' click', functionality( e) \ne.preventDefault().\n\n$(' html, physical body'). make alive(.\n\nscrollTop: $($( this). attr(' href')). countered(). best,.\n,.\nFive hundred,.\n' linear'.\n).\n ).\n\nThis code will certainly make a hassle-free scrolling effect whenever the customer selects a hyperlink that features a

sign in the href feature. The code targets all such web links and also includes a click activity audience to them. When the user clicks on a link, the code will certainly avoid the default activity of the web link (i.e., getting through to a brand new webpage) as well as rather make alive the web page to scroll easily to the area of the webpage indicated by the web link's href quality.Dropdown Menus.Dropdown menus are a popular UI factor that can easily help to organize content as well as improve the navigating of your website. With JavaScript, you can easily generate dropdown menus that are easy to use and instinctive for your customers.To generate a fundamental dropdown menu with JavaScript, you can easily make use of the observing code:.var dropdown = document.querySelector('. dropdown').var dropdownToggle = dropdown.querySelector('. dropdown-toggle').var dropdownMenu = dropdown.querySelector('. dropdown-menu').dropdownToggle.addEventListener(' click on', function() if (dropdownMenu.classList.contains(' program')) dropdownMenu.classList.remove(' show'). else dropdownMenu.classList.add(' program'). ).This code will certainly generate a basic dropdown menu that can be toggled through clicking a button with the class dropdown-toggle. When the switch is clicked, the code will certainly examine if the dropdown food selection possesses the course program. If it performs, the code will certainly get rid of the training class, concealing the dropdown menu. If it doesn't, the code will definitely add the class, showing the dropdown food selection.Modal Windows.Modal windows are yet another preferred UI factor that may be utilized to display crucial info or even to motivate the individual for input. Along with JavaScript, you may generate modal home windows that are actually reactive, available, and also easy to use.To create a standard modal home window along with JavaScript, you may make use of the following code:.var modal = document.querySelector('. modal').var modalToggle = document.querySelector('. modal-toggle').var modalClose = modal.querySelector('. modal-close').modalToggle.addEventListener(' click', functionality() modal.classList.add(' show'). ).modalClose.addEventListener(' click on', functionality() modal.classList.remove(' program'). ).This code will definitely create a modal home window that could be toggled through clicking a switch along with the lesson modal-toggle. When the button is clicked on, the code will incorporate the course show to the modal home window, displaying it on the page. When the close switch along with the class modal-close is clicked on, the code is going to eliminate the series class, hiding the modal window.Sliders.Sliders are a prominent UI factor that can be utilized to present images or even various other kinds of content in a visually pleasing and appealing method. Along with JavaScript, you can easily make sliders that are actually simple to use as well as customizable to match your site's layout.To create a fundamental slider along with JavaScript, you may make use of the complying with code:.var slider = document.querySelector('. slider').var slides = slider.querySelectorAll('. slide').var prevButton = slider.querySelector('. prev').var nextButton = slider.querySelector('. next').var currentSlide = 0.function showSlide( n) slides [currentSlide] classList.remove(' energetic').slides [n] classList.add(' energetic').currentSlide = n.prevButton.addEventListener(' click', function() var prevSlide = currentSlide - 1.if (prevSlide &lt &lt 0) prevSlide = slides.length - 1.showSlide( prevSlide). ).nextButton.addEventListener(' click', function() var nextSlide = currentSlide + 1.if (nextSlide &gt&gt= slides.length) nextSlide = 0.showSlide( nextSlide). ).This code will produce a slider that could be browsed by clicking on switches with the classes prev as well as upcoming. The code uses the showSlide feature to reveal the present slide and also hide the previous slide whenever the slider is actually browsed.Form Recognition.Type recognition is a vital UX component that may help to stop errors and also strengthen the usability of your internet site's types. Along with JavaScript, you can easily generate kind recognition that is actually reactive and user-friendly.To make form recognition along with JavaScript, you may use the adhering to code:.var kind = document.querySelector(' type').form.addEventListener(' send', feature( e) ).This code will verify a document's email as well as password areas when the application is submitted. If either range is actually empty, the code is going to display an alert message urging the user to fill in all fields. If the security password industry is less than 8 signs long, the code will certainly feature an alert message causing the consumer to get in a security password that is at the very least 8 characters long. If the kind passes validation, the code will definitely present a sharp information signifying that the type was provided efficiently.In conclusion, JavaScript is actually a highly effective device that may be utilized to boost the UX as well as UI of your site. By utilizing these JavaScript bits, you can produce a more stimulating and also uncomplicated experience for your individuals. Nevertheless, it is very important to make use of these JavaScript snippets wisely and sparingly to guarantee that they perform certainly not adversely affect the efficiency of your site.This article might include partner hyperlinks. Find our acknowledgment concerning affiliate web links here.